Modern sports psychology often utilizes specific mental skill frameworks to help athletes reach peak performance:

: A common framework used to describe key mental qualities: Commitment , Communication , Concentration , Control , and Confidence .

: A simplified version focusing on Confidence , Control , Commitment , and Concentration .

: Developing SMART goals (Specific, Measurable, Attainable, Relevant, and Time-bound) to improve motivation.
